A house is burning on West Clark Street in Eureka. The report came in about 2:20 p.m.

Flames are coming from the back of the home. Firefighters are on scene as of 2:30 p.m.

UPDATE 2:40 p.m.: Firefighters have located a cat and a dog who are both alive, according to the scanner. Animal Control officer has been requested to come care for the two pets.

UPDATE 3 p.m.: Our reporter tells us there are cats and dogs being rescued from the home. He is unsure of how many.

UPDATE 3:40 p.m.: Reports from neighbors indicate there were nine dogs and they are all accounted for except one that ran into the bushes across the street. At least two cats were also rescued.
